Buscar

BDQ Prova

Esta é uma pré-visualização de arquivo. Entre para ver o arquivo original

Processando, aguarde ...
		
 	
	 
	
	 
   DESENVOLVIMENTO DE SOFTWARE
	
	Simulado: CCT0248_SM_201407324667 V.1 	 
 
 Fechar 
	Aluno(a): 
 RENATO MACIEL PEREIRA	Matrícula: 
 201407324667 
	Desempenho: 
 10,0 de 10,0	Data: 
 20/05/2016 10:36:06 (Finalizada)
		
			 
			
			
				
		
				
 	 1a Questão (Ref.: 201407534177)	sem. N/A: O .NET Framework	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	O
 .NET Framework é uma iniciativa da empresa Microsoft, que visa uma 
plataforma única para desenvolvimento e execução de sistemas e 
aplicações, assim Todo e qualquer código gerado para .NET,
		
					
							
							 
					
					
	
 
 
 
 
 
 	pode ser executado em qualquer dispositivo que possua um framework de tal plataforma.
	
 
 
 
 	pode ser executado em qualquer dispositivo que possua qualquer versão de framework de qualquer plataforma.
	
 
 
 
 	pode ser executado em qualquer dispositivo que possua uma versão do Windows.
	
 
 
 
 	pode ser executado em qualquer dispositivo que possua a mesma versão Windows da máquina onde foi desenvolvido.
	
							
							 
							
						 	pode ser executado em qualquer dispositivo.
	
						 	 Gabarito Comentado.
						
						
	
			 
			
			
				
		
				
 	 2a Questão (Ref.: 201407496812)	sem. N/A: INTRODUÇÃO	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	Uma
 empresa deseja adquirir uma edição do Visual Studio 2010 que permita a 
sua equipe de desenvolvimento trabalhar com um conjunto de ferramentas 
de gerenciamento de ciclo de vida da aplicação, incluindo a elaboração 
de diagramas UML e o gerenciamento de projetos com metodologias 
iterativas e ágeis. Qual a edição do Visual Studio 2010 mais indicada?
		
					
							
							 
					
					
	
 
 
 
 	Visual Studio 2010 Express
	
 
 
 
 	Visual Studio 2010 Professional
	
 
 
 
 
 
 	Visual Studio 2010 Ultimate
	
 
 
 
 	Visual Studio 2010 Test Professional 2010
	
							
							 
							
						 	Visual Studio 2010 Premium
	
						 	 Gabarito Comentado.	 Gabarito Comentado.
						
						
	
			 
			
			
				
		
				
 	 3a Questão (Ref.: 201407534184)	2a sem.: Operadores	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	Um desenvolvedor precisa identificar se o valor inteiro armazenado em uma variável (var) é par, para isso ele deverá usar:
		
					
							
							 
					
					
	
 
 
 
 	var ^ 2 = 0
	
 
 
 
 	var & 2 = 0
	
 
 
 
 
 
 	var mod 2 = 0
	
 
 
 
 	var \ 2 = 0
	
							
							 
							
						 	var / 2 = 0
	
						 	 Gabarito Comentado.	 Gabarito Comentado.
						
						
	
			 
			
			
				
		
				
 	 4a Questão (Ref.: 201408064904)	2a sem.: Programação VB	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	Na
 linguagem VB.Net a conhecer e saber utilizar corretamente os operadores
 está dentre as rotinas iniciais e de muita importância. Analise o 
código apresentado na questão: 
Module Module1
 Sub Main() 
 Dim resp As String 
 Dim x, y, z As Integer 
 x = 1 
 y = 2 
 z = 2 
 resp = "sistema" 
 If Not (y = 3 AndAlso z = 2) Then 
 Console.Write("AndAlso") 
 End If 
 If (resp Like "??st*") Then 
 Console.Write("Like") 
 End If 
 End Sub 
End Module 
Qual das respostas apresenta o resultado exibido da mesma forma que na tela pelo programa. 
		
					
							
							 
					
					
	
 
 
 
 	AndAlso 
Like
	
 
 
 
 	AndAlso
	
 
 
 
 	Like
	
 
 
 
 
 
 	AndAlsoLike
	
							
							 
							
						 	Não será exibido nada.
	
						 	 Gabarito Comentado.	 Gabarito Comentado.	 Gabarito Comentado.
						
						
	
			 
			
			
				
		
				
 	 5a Questão (Ref.: 201407998899)	6a sem.: Modularização	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	Assinale a alternativa correta a respeito da passagem de parâmetros na linguagem de programação VB.NET.
		
					
							
							 
					
					
	
 
 
 
 	Em
 VB.NET, para passar um parâmetro por valor, a palavra reservada ByVal 
deve ser usada na definição da assinatura da função ou subrotina, 
precedendo o identificador do parâmetro.
	
 
 
 
 	Em 
VB.NET os parâmetros são passados por referência, exceto quando a 
palavra reservada ByVal é associada ao parâmetro na assinatura da função
 ou subrotina, indicando que ele deve ser passado por valor.
	
 
 
 
 	Nenhuma das anteriores
	
 
 
 
 
 
 	Em
 VB.NET, para passar um parâmetro por valor, a palavra reservada ByVal 
deve ser usada na definição da assinatura da função ou subrotina, 
precedendo o identificador do parâmetro, seguido da definição do tipo. 
	
							
							 
							
						 	Em
 VB.NET, para passar um parâmetro por referência, a palavra reservada 
ByRef deve ser usada na chamada da função ou subrotina, precedendo o 
valor do argumento. 
	
						 
						
						
	
			 
			
			
				
		
				
 	 6a Questão (Ref.: 201407534186)	3a sem.: Métodos	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	Um
 desenvolvedor precisa de um código que receba o valor do lado de um 
quadrado, calcule e retorne a área deste quadrado, ele deverá usar qual 
das opções de código a seguir?
		
					
							
							 
					
					
	
 
 
 
 	Module AreaQuad (ByVal n As Integer)
     Dim S As Integer
     S = n * n
     Console.WriteLine("Area:
" & S)
End Module
	
 
 
 
 	Function AreaQuad (ByVal n As Integer)
     Dim S As Integer
     S = n * n
     Console.WriteLine("Area: " & S)
End Function
	
 
 
 
 
 
 	Function AreaQuad (ByVal n As Integer)
     Dim S As Integer
     S = n * n
     Return S
End Function
	
 
 
 
 	Sub AreaQuad (ByVal n As Integer)
     Dim S As Integer
     S = n * n
     Console.WriteLine("Area: " & S)
End Sub
	
							
							 
							
						 	Sub AreaQuad (ByVal n As Integer)
     Dim S As Integer
     S = n * n
     Return S
End Sub
	
						 	 Gabarito Comentado.
						
						
	
			 
			
			
				
		
				
 	 7a Questão (Ref.: 201407497760)	4a sem.: PROGRAMAÇÃO ESTRUTURADA	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	Das
 Estruturas de Controle de Repetição apresentadas abaixo, qual é 
diretamente controlada por um contador como parte da própria estrutura:
		
					
							
							 
					
					
	
 
 
 
 	Do
	
 
 
 
 
 
 	For
	
 
 
 
 	Until
	
 
 
 
 	Repeat
	
							
							 
							
						 	While
	
						 	 Gabarito Comentado.	 Gabarito Comentado.
						
						
	
			 
			
			
				
		
				
 	 8a Questão (Ref.: 201407496859)	4a sem.: PROGRAMAÇÃO ESTRUTURADA	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	O código em VB apresentado está funcionando corretamente.
Module Module1
     Private texto As String
     Sub Main()
         Dim Num As Byte
         texto = "Teste de software"
         Num = 18
         If (Len(texto) > Num) Then
             Console.Write("Maior!")
         ElseIf (Len(texto) < Num) Then
             Console.Write("Menor!")
         ElseIf (Len(texto) = Num) Then
             Console.Write("Acertou!")
         End If
         Console.ReadKey()
     End Sub
End Module
Das opções apresentadas qual melhor representa o resultado exibido pelo programa:
		
					
							
							 
					
					
	
 
 
 
 	Exibe no console o texto: Acertou!
	
 
 
 
 
 
 	Exibe no console o texto: Menor!
	
 
 
 
 	Exibe no console o texto: Maior!
	
 
 
 
 	Exibe em uma caixa de diálogo o texto: Maior!
	
							
							 
							
						 	Exibe em uma caixa de diálogo o texto: Menor!
	
						 	 Gabarito Comentado.	 Gabarito Comentado.
						
						
	
			 
			
			
				
		
				
 	 9a Questão (Ref.: 201407923902)	sem. N/A: Aula 5	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	O
 tratamento de exceção é o mecanismo responsável pelo tratamento da 
ocorrência de condições que alteram o fluxo normal da execução dos 
programas. Ou seja, permite a detecção e tratamento de bugs que podem 
ocorrer durante a execução do programa. A exceção definida pelo .NET 
lançada quando é feita uma tentativa para acessar um elemento de uma 
matriz com um índice que está fora dos limites da matriz, além de não 
poder ser herdada é chamada:
		
					
							
							 
					
					
	
 
 
 
 	ArgumentNullException
	
 
 
 
 	OverflowException
	
 
 
 
 	NotImplementedException
	
 
 
 
 	FileNotFoundException
	
							
							 
							
							 
							
						 	IndexOutOfRangeException
	
						 	 Gabarito Comentado.	 Gabarito Comentado.	 Gabarito Comentado.
						
						
	
			 
			
			
				
		
				
 	 10a Questão (Ref.: 201407590341)	sem. N/A: Exceção	
				 
				 	Pontos: 
					
							1,0
						
					 / 1,0 
					
					
			
				
 	Uma
 Exceção é um erro no fluxo normal de execução do código de um programa 
de uma aplicação. Em algumas situações você pode desejar lançar uma 
exceção para que seja tratada por uma rotina de tratamento, chamada:
		
					
							
							 
					
					
	
 
 
 
 	Try
	
 
 
 
 	Exception
	
 
 
 
 	Catch
	
 
 
 
 
 
 	Throw
	
							
							 
							
						 	Finally
	
						 	 Gabarito Comentado.	 Gabarito Comentado.
						
						
	
		 
			
			 	
 	 
					
	
			
			
	 	Período 
 de não visualização da prova: desde até .

Teste o Premium para desbloquear

Aproveite todos os benefícios por 3 dias sem pagar! 😉
Já tem cadastro?

Continue navegando